On Fri, Mar 27, 2026 at 08:22:35AM +0100, Aleksandr Loktionov wrote:
> From: Lukasz Czapnik <lukasz.czapnik@intel.com>
>
> Fix unreachable code: the conditionals in ice_set_pauseparam() used
> the bitwise-AND operator suggesting aq_failures is a bitmap, but it
> is actually an enum, making the third condition logically unreachable.
>
> Replace the if-else ladder with a switch statement. Also move the
> aq_failures initialization to the variable declaration and remove the
> redundant zeroing from ice_set_fc().
I think that this second part feels more like a clean-up
than part of the fix. But I don't feel strongly about it.
